2,4-Bis(fluoroalkyl)quinoline-3-carboxylates as Tools for the Development of Potential Agrochemical Ingredients

Résumé

From an easy and scalable synthetic access to quinoline derivatives substituted by fluorinated groups in both C2-and C4-positions developed in our laboratory, we devised the synthesis of a new series of unprecedented 2,4-bis(fluoroalkyl)quinoline-3-carboxylates in two steps only. After standard saponification, the latter afforded their corresponding 2,4-bis(fluoroalkyl)quinoline-3-carboxylic acids, which served as pivotal intermediates for post-functionalization reactions. Indeed, the carboxylic function could then be derived according to known procedures and allowed the introduction of chemical diversity in C3-position of these unprecedented structures. The resulting highly functionalized quinolines will then serve as platform in the development of ingredients with strong potential for agrochemical research.
